The Freeze-Thaw Cycle That Fractures Brick From Within in Bayard

Water absorbed into the masonry through deteriorated mortar joints freezes when temperatures drop below freezing in Bayard, NE. Water expands approximately 9 percent when it freezes, generating physical pressure within the masonry pores in Bayard. This pressure fractures brick faces from the brick body, opens mortar joints further than weathering alone produces, and progressively degrades the masonry assembly from within with every freeze-thaw cycle in Bayard, NE. The process is invisible from the outside until the brick faces begin separating visibly in Bayard. By the time spalling is visible, the freeze-thaw process has been occurring through multiple cold seasons in Bayard, NE.

How Water Infiltration Through Mortar Spreads the Damage in Bayard

Water entering through a deteriorated mortar joint does not stay at the entry point in Bayard, NE. It migrates through the interconnected pore structure of the brick and mortar outward from the entry point in Bayard. Adjacent mortar joints that have not yet eroded to the point of visible deterioration are being saturated from within by water that entered through the adjacent failed joint in Bayard, NE. The damage area is always larger than the visible deterioration area in Bayard. Why Mortar Is Intentionally Softer Than Brick in Bayard

Mortar in a brick chimney is the sacrificial component of the masonry system in Bayard, NE. It is specifically engineered to be softer than the surrounding brick so that when the chimney assembly experiences thermal cycling, settling, or physical stress, the mortar joint accommodates that stress through gradual erosion rather than transmitting it to the brick faces in Bayard. This design keeps the brick faces intact while the mortar erodes, allowing repointing to restore the joint without replacing the brick in Bayard, NE. The system only works correctly when the mortar hardness is correctly matched to the hardness of the surrounding brick in Bayard.

What Happens When a Repointing Mortar Is Too Hard in Bayard, NE

Repointing mortar that is harder than the surrounding brick reverses the masonry system's designed failure mode in Bayard. The joint is now the stiffest element. Thermal and physical stress that should be accommodated through gradual mortar erosion is transmitted directly to the brick face in Bayard, NE. The brick face fractures and spalls away from the brick body over the first two to three freeze-thaw seasons after the repointing in Bayard. The homeowner has paid for a repointing that has produced brick face damage requiring brick replacement in Bayard, NE. The cause is incorrect mortar specification in Bayard. How Topdown Chimney Specifies Mortar for the Specific Chimney in Bayard, NE

Topdown Chimney assesses the existing masonry before specifying any repointing mortar in Bayard. The age of the chimney provides the first indicator because older chimneys used softer lime-based mortars that are incompatible with modern Portland cement-based mortars in Bayard, NE. The condition and composition of the existing mortar provides additional information in Bayard. And for historic chimneys of uncertain composition, Topdown Chimney specifies a formulation that errs toward the softer end of the appropriate range to protect the brick faces in Bayard, NE.

Why Removal Depth Is as Critical as Mix Design in Bayard

New mortar applied over old deteriorated mortar without adequate removal depth bonds to the surface of the old mortar rather than to the brick faces in Bayard, NE. The bond is only as strong as the weakest layer, which is the deteriorated old mortar in Bayard. Surface application fails within two to five seasons as the deteriorated old mortar continues to erode and releases the surface application in Bayard, NE. Repointing and tuckpointing describe the same fundamental process in Bayard: removing deteriorated mortar from between chimney bricks and replacing it with correctly specified fresh mortar in Bayard, NE. Tuckpointing sometimes specifically refers to a decorative technique using two contrasting mortar colors, but in common usage the terms refer to the mortar joint restoration process in Bayard.
